MBAD 6309 - Business Models and Business Plans


Examines the formulation of business models and plans to detail how to appropriate value from recognized opportunities and innovative solutions.  The business model captures a static view of the decisions needed to be made to create value, whereas the business plan provides a dynamic view of the decisions and investments needed to support a business’s specific growth objectives.

Credit Hours: (3)
